Bony Labyrinth
The rigid, outer structure of the inner ear, comprising the cochlea, vestibule, and semicircular canals, and contains the vestibular and auditory apparatus.
Otoliths
Otoliths are small, calcium carbonate crystals in the inner ear that contribute to the sense of balance and orientation by detecting head movements and gravity.
Stereocilia
Hairlike projections on the surface of certain cells, such as those in the inner ear, which are involved in the mechanosensation process.
